The Principal HR Business Partner is a key role within the HRBP team as we transition towards a new way of working with our stakeholders across the agency. You will lead the team to explore and implement contemporary HR initiatives, undertake strategic workforce planning, introduce new ways of working, and bring to the role a myriad of HR practitioner skillsets and experiences.
You will work collaboratively with your colleagues and clients across the Department to explore and implement new HR initiatives, including coaching on positive performance management, succession management, managing grievances from end to end, and moving from transactional HR to strategic business partnering.
You currently have three direct reports however, this may change over time as we move towards a new way of working.

About the role
As our Principal HR Business Partner, you will:
- Lead strategic and capability development initiatives and provide specialist human resources (HR) knowledge and skills in the areas of career development, performance, diversity and inclusion, establishment management and analytics, employee relations, safety, wellbeing and injury management.
- Lead a team of HR Business Partners (individual contributors) to deliver high quality HR services, workforce and workplace culture initiatives.
- Provide strategic HR advice to senior executives and managers to design, develop and engage stakeholders to build a contemporary workforce.
- Provide independent HR analysis and advice and contribute to the evaluation of human resources services and initiatives to ensure these are directed to supporting business outcomes.
- Be a liaison point within People and Culture for human resource management activities to ensure that the development and implementation of related policies, programs and services meet business requirements.
- Lead strategies to enhance the department's capability and capacity to improve service quality and responsiveness to customers.
- Prepare accurate, timely and relevant workforce reports, business cases, submissions, briefings and correspondence.
- Contribute to and participate in a range of HR Business Partnering and broader People and Culture team agendas including selection panels, team meetings, HR leadership sessions, strategic and business planning.
